Hawk provides AI-powered financial-crime detection software for banks, payment companies, neobanks and fintechs, covering anti-money laundering, payment screening and fraud prevention. The company says its explainable AI models have pushed prediction accuracy to almost 90% in some cases while cutting false alarms in half, and it offers both SaaS and private-cloud deployment for regulated institutions. Hawk is led by managing directors Wolfgang Berner and Tobias Schweiger and is registered in Munich. The company sells directly to banks and other regulated financial institutions rather than through a self-serve product.
